SQL Server中更新当前时间的方法

在数据库管理系统中,更新数据是一个非常常见的操作。有时候我们需要将某个字段的值更新为当前时间,比如记录最后更新时间等。在SQL Server中,我们可以使用内置函数GETDATE()来获取当前时间,然后将其赋值给需要更新的字段。本文将介绍如何在SQL Server中更新当前时间的方法,并给出代码示例。

更新当前时间的方法

在SQL Server中,我们可以使用UPDATE语句来更新表中的数据。如果我们想要将某个字段的值更新为当前时间,我们可以使用GETDATE()函数来获取当前时间。然后将其作为更新值传入UPDATE语句中。

下面是更新表中某个字段为当前时间的SQL语句示例:

UPDATE TableName
SET ColumnName = GETDATE()
WHERE Condition;

在这个示例中,TableName是要更新的表名,ColumnName是要更新为当前时间的字段名,Condition是更新的条件。

代码示例

假设我们有一个名为Employees的表,其中包含员工的信息,我们想要更新表中的LastUpdated字段为当前时间。下面是一个示例的SQL语句:

UPDATE Employees
SET LastUpdated = GETDATE()
WHERE EmployeeID = 123;

通过这个SQL语句,我们可以将EmployeeID为123的员工的LastUpdated字段更新为当前时间。

状态图示例

下面是一个使用mermaid语法表示的状态图示例,展示了更新当前时间的流程:

stateDiagram
    [*] --> Update
    Update --> [*]

饼状图示例

下面是一个使用mermaid语法表示的饼状图示例,展示了员工信息更新情况:

pie
    title Employee Info Update
    "Updated" : 75
    "Not Updated" : 25

结论

通过本文的介绍,我们了解了在SQL Server中更新当前时间的方法,通过使用GETDATE()函数可以轻松地将某个字段更新为当前时间。同时,我们也给出了具体的代码示例和状态图、饼状图,希望对你有所帮助。如果你有任何问题或者疑问,请随时留言,我们会尽力帮助你解决问题。